Speedball | |
---|---|
Speedball | 1988 |
Speedball 2: Brutal Deluxe | 1991 |
Speedball 2: Tournament | 2007 |
Speedball 2: Evolution | 2011 |
Speedball 2 HD | 2013 |

System requirements
Windows | ||
---|---|---|
Minimum | ||
Operating system (OS) | XP (SP3) | |
Processor (CPU) | AMD Athlon 64 4000+ (2600 MHz) Intel Pentium D 950 Extreme (3400 MHz) |
|
System memory (RAM) | 1 GB | |
Hard disk drive (HDD) | 300 MB | |
Video card (GPU) | ATi Radeon X1300 Pro, NVIDIA GeForce 6200 TurboCache or Intel HD Graphics |

- ↑ 1.0 1.1 Notes regarding Steam Play (Linux) data:
- File/folder structure within this directory reflects the path(s) listed for Windows and/or Steam game data.
- Games with Steam Cloud support may also store data in
~/.steam/steam/userdata/<user-id>/251690/
. - Use Wine's registry editor to access any Windows registry paths.
- The app ID (251690) may differ in some cases.
- Treat backslashes as forward slashes.
- See the glossary page for details on Windows data paths.
